Subject: Re: [PATCH v5 19/24] x86/resctrl: Add helpers for system wide mon/alloc capable
Date: Thu, 17 Aug 2023 11:34:39 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<99939c7d-3c8d-f1d4-9226-81f32925e045@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230728164254.27562-20-james.morse@arm.com>

Hi, James,

On 7/28/23 09:42, James Morse wrote:
> resctrl reads rdt_alloc_capable or rdt_mon_capable to determine
> whether any of the resources support the corresponding features.
> resctrl also uses the static-keys that affect the architecture's
> context-switch code to determine the same thing.
> 
> This forces another architecture to have the same static-keys.
> 
> As the static-key is enabled based on the capable flag, and none of
> the filesystem uses of these are in the scheduler path, move the
> capable flags behind helpers, and use these in the filesystem
> code instead of the static-key.
> 
> After this change, only the architecture code manages and uses
> the static-keys to ensure __resctrl_sched_in() does not need
> runtime checks.
> 
> This avoids multiple architectures having to define the same
> static-keys.
> 
> Cases where the static-key implicitly tested if the resctrl
> filesystem was mounted all have an explicit check added by a
> previous patch.

Why isn't rdt_alloc_capable in get_rdt_alloc_resources() replaced by the 
helper?

static __init bool get_rdt_alloc_resources(void)
{
...
         if (rdt_alloc_capable)
...
